Now for those chicks someone mentioned? My Delawares will do fine with younger birds BUT that means I have to switch the entire coop to non medicated grower. The grower I use is more $$ than the Egg Producer I use, and it's quite while before I can get them all back on layers.

Point? It might be okay to put the youngsters in with the older birds but you will have to switch everyone to grower. AND you may need to watch for soft shelled eggs.
